前言
据说,当今只有一种语言的性能比C语言强,那就是汇编语言,优化过的C程序的速度大约是汇编的95%-98%。但汇编基本不是常人用的。所以实际上C就是最快的语言。C是面向过程的编程语言,C++在某种意义上来说是C语言的一个升级版,是面向对象的编程语言。
在众多的编程语言中,有各种各样的语言,但大多数语言都离不开这两种语言:C语言和C++。
“成为编程大牛要一门好语言加一点点天分。一门好语言,一点点天分,再加一份坚持。要是天分少,光靠坚持也行。”

书单目录总结
零.手册类:
- 《C++程序设计语言(The C++ Programming Language)》
- 《C++标准程序库(C++ Standard Library Tutorial and Reference) 》
- 《The C++ IO Streams and Locales》
- 《The C++ Standard (INCITS/ISO/IEC 14882-2011)》
- 《Overview of the New C++ (C++11/14) 》
- 《The Standard C Library》
一.初级入门系列:
- 《C++ Primer》
- 《Accelerated C++》
- 《C++编程思想(Thinking in C++) 》
- 《C++程序设计原理与实践(Programming: Principles and Practice Using C++ )》
- 《C++初学者指南》
- 《C++ Primer Plus》
- 《Visual.C++.2008入门经典》
- 《面向对象程序设计—C++语言描述》
- 《数据结构(C++语言版)第三版_邓俊辉》
二.实用系列:
- 《Effective C++ 》
- 《Effective STL》
- 《深入浅出设计模式》
- 《设计模式:可复用面向对象软件的基础》
- 《HeadFirst设计模式》
- 《大话设计模式》
三.中级进阶系列:
- 《More Effective C++ 》
- 《Exceptional C++ 》
- 《More Exceptional C++》
- 《Exceptional C++ Style》
- 《C++编程规范(C++ Coding Standards) 》
- 《C++ 模板完全指南(C++ Templates: The Complete Guide)》
- 《Beyond the C++ Standard Library(Boost)》
- 《C和C++安全编码》
- 《深入理解C++11》
VS编译器,图形库

C语言相关电子书

C/C++基础视频及笔记

C/C++项目实战

日积月累,终有所成!!!
文章福利
对于自己找不到视频、书籍资源的读者,可以加小编的C语言/C++交流群:967051845!整理了一些个人觉得比较好的学习书籍、视频资料共享在群文件里面,有需要的可以自行添加哦!~
网友评论